#101577 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#101577 is composed of 6.3% red, 8.2% green and 46.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.6% cyan, 82.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 53.3% black. It has a hue angle of 237.1 degrees, a saturation of 76.3% and a lightness of 26.5%. #101577 color hex could be obtained by blending #202aee with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000066.

● #101577 color description : Dark blue.
The hexadecimal color #101577 has RGB values of R:16, G:21, B:119 and CMYK values of C:0.87, M:0.82, Y:0, K:0.53. Its decimal value is 1054071.
